OH41 Hall effect Latch Switch IC is composed of a reverse protector, voltage regulator, Hall voltage generator, differential amplifier, Schmitt trigger and an open-collector output on a single silicon chip. It can convert the magnetic field signal into digital voltage output, in response to N and S alternating magnetic field.

Precautions of OH Series Hall ICS
Hall ICs are sensitive devices which performance could be influenced in some extent by magnetic, optical, thermal and mechanical stress.
1) A pull-up resistor RL should be connected between the power supply (Vcc) and the output (Vout) since most of hall ICs are open collector output (OC output) circuits, such as OH44E, OH137, OH513, OH543. Hall ICs with Build-in Resistor are not necessary to add one, for example OH921.
2) Avoid reversing the power supply (Vcc) and the output (Vout) as well as no overload use. Be careful of the burn and damage caused by instant large current and instantaneous high voltage.
3) The Protection circuit should be added in the test circuits of hall ICs, such as large capacitor and a voltage stabilizing diode, which could absorb the effects of the external circuit and power fluctuation.
4) Try to minimize the mechanical stress applied to the device and leads during the installation, especially on the pins where close to the root of the device when bending shaping etc.
5) Strictly regulate the welding temperature and time. When manual welding, the temperature of soldering iron shall not exceed 260℃and time should be less than 3 seconds.
6) When designing, please fully consider the influence factors of temperature, magnetic field attenuation, the movement way, etc.
